Cancer is a disorder in which some cells lose the ability to control their?

growth and division, leading to the formation of tumors. These cells can also invade nearby tissues and spread to other parts of the body. Proper treatment involves targeting and destroying these cancerous cells while minimizing harm to healthy cells.


Why can cancer be considered a disease of the cell cycle?

because cancer happens when control over the cell cycle has broken down the cell cycle is the series of events that cells go through as they grow and divide, and cancer is a disorder in which some of the body's cells lose the ability to control growth


Do both animal and plant cells retain the ability to differentiate throughout their life?

Plant cells have the ability to differentiate throughout their life, allowing for growth and development. Animal cells typically lose the ability to differentiate once they mature, but certain cells, such as stem cells, retain this ability for repair and regeneration.
